Benin - Use of insecticide treated bed nets

Use of insecticide-treated bed nets (% of under-5 population)

Definition: Use of insecticide-treated bed nets refers to the percentage of children under age five who slept under an insecticide-treated bednet to prevent malaria.

Source: UNICEF, State of the World's Children, Childinfo, and Demographic and Health Surveys.

Year Value
2001 7.00
2006 20.30
2012 69.70
2014 72.70
2018 76.30
